Alltel Subsidiary, Western Wireless LLC, Announces Preliminary Results of Tender Offer and Consent Solicitation for its 9.250 pe
August 12 2005 - 8:59AM
Business Wire
Western Wireless LLC announced the results to date of its
previously announced tender offer for any and all of its
outstanding 9.250 percent Senior Notes due 2013 (the "Notes"), as
well as its related consent solicitation. As of 5 p.m. EDT, on
Thursday, Aug. 11, 2005 (the "Consent Date"), the last day and time
for holders to deliver their Notes pursuant to the tender offer and
be eligible to receive the Total Consideration including the
Consent Fee, holders of approximately $581,977,000 in aggregate
principal amount of Notes had tendered their Notes pursuant to the
tender offer and delivered their consents pursuant to the consent
solicitation. This participation represents approximately 97
percent of the total principal amount of Notes outstanding. Notes
tendered prior to the Consent Date may no longer be withdrawn and
consents delivered prior to the Consent date may no longer be
revoked. Western Wireless also announced that it has received the
requisite consents to adopt the proposed amendments pursuant to the
consent solicitation. As a result, Western Wireless and the
indenture trustee are executing a supplemental indenture in respect
of such amendments. Holders who validly tendered their Notes by the
Consent Date will be eligible to receive the Total Consideration
offered in the tender offer and consent solicitation. Holders who
validly tender their Notes after the Consent Date, and on or prior
to midnight, EDT, Aug. 26, 2005 (the "Expiration Date"), will be
eligible to receive the Total Consideration less the consent fee of
$45.00 per $1,000 principal amount, namely the Tender Offer
Consideration. Notes validly tendered prior to the Consent Date
will have a settlement date of Aug. 15, 2005. Notes validly
tendered after the Consent Date and on or prior to the Expiration
Date will have a settlement date one business day following the
expiration of the tender offer. In either case, holders whose Notes
are purchased will be paid accrued and unpaid interest up to, but
not including, the applicable settlement date. Barclays Capital and

(toll free). About Western Wireless LLC Western Wireless LLC, a
wholly-owned subsidiary of Alltel Corporation, serves over 1.5
million subscribers in 19 western states under the Cellular One(R)
and Western Wireless(R) brand names. Western Wireless LLC, through
its subsidiary, Western Wireless International Corporation,
currently serves over 1.9 million customers in six international
markets, and owns a minority interest in a seventh market. This
